Choosing Vinmec Hai Phong for Fontan Procedure gives patients access to experienced congenital cardiac surgeons, advanced cardiovascular imaging, pediatric intensive care facilities, and structured postoperative management. Established in 2018, the JCI accredited hospital in Ha noi, Vietnam has 200 beds and provides specialised congenital and cardiothoracic surgical services.

The Fontan Procedure is performed under general anaesthesia and involves rerouting venous blood directly to the pulmonary arteries. Different surgical approaches may be used depending on the patient's anatomy, including an extracardiac conduit or lateral tunnel technique. After surgery, patients are closely monitored for circulation, oxygenation, heart rhythm, fluid balance, and other potential complications. Long-term follow-up is important because Fontan circulation requires ongoing cardiac assessment throughout life.

Vinmec Ha Long Hospital provides specialized Fontan Procedure with a focus on precise surgical reconstruction, advanced congenital cardiac techniques, and individualized postoperative care. Established in 2018, the JCI accredited hospital is located in Ha noi, Vietnam and operates 500 beds, with modern pediatric cardiac surgical and critical-care infrastructure.

The Fontan Procedure can establish a circulation in which systemic venous blood flows directly to the lungs without being pumped by a ventricle. By reducing the volume load on the functional ventricle, the procedure can improve oxygenation and support circulation in appropriately selected patients with single-ventricle physiology. A detailed assessment before surgery helps the cardiac team determine the patient's readiness for Fontan completion and plan the most suitable surgical technique.

At Vinmec Central Park International Hospital, Fontan Procedure is performed using specialized congenital cardiac surgical techniques and comprehensive preoperative cardiovascular assessment. Established in 2015, this JCI accredited hospital in Ho Chi Minh, Vietnam has 178 beds and offers advanced pediatric and adult congenital cardiac services.

The Fontan Procedure may be considered for patients with complex heart defects such as hypoplastic left heart syndrome, tricuspid atresia, or other conditions resulting in single-ventricle physiology. The surgical team connects the systemic venous circulation directly to the pulmonary arteries, allowing blood to reach the lungs without being pumped there by a ventricle. Detailed assessment may include echocardiography, cardiac catheterisation, CT or MRI imaging, and evaluation of lung and ventricular function before surgery.

Vinmec Phu Quoc Hospital is a trusted healthcare provider for Fontan Procedure, offering complex congenital heart surgery supported by experienced pediatric cardiac surgeons, specialised operating facilities, and multidisciplinary cardiovascular care. Established in 2015, the JCI accredited hospital is situated in Phu Quoc, Vietnam and has 150 beds.

The Fontan Procedure is generally the final stage of a staged surgical pathway for patients with single-ventricle heart defects. It redirects blood from the superior and inferior vena cava directly into the pulmonary arteries, reducing the workload on the functional ventricle and improving circulatory efficiency. Before surgery, the cardiac team evaluates ventricular function, pulmonary artery anatomy, heart rhythm, oxygen levels, and other factors that may influence suitability for Fontan circulation.
